Exploring the Vanilla Extract Industry Landscape
The vanilla extract industry thrives on the demand for natural ingredients. Consumers, preferring genuine flavors, are avoiding artificial additives, boosting demand for authentic vanilla extract.
Two types of vanilla extract are available: natural and synthetic. Natural extract, made from vanilla beans, offers a rich, complex flavor. Synthetic vanilla, created from guaiacol or lignin, mimics vanilla's flavor but lacks depth.
Trends show a strong consumer preference for natural products. People are willing to pay more for quality, making the pursuit of high-grade vanilla beans essential. Authenticity and purity in vanilla extract are crucial, as quality builds trust and establishes your brand as a leader in the culinary field. The Importance of Vanilla Bean Quality and Sourcing
The quality of your vanilla extract depends on the beans you choose, making sourcing essential. Premium vanilla beans are crucial for a superior extract, providing rich, authentic flavors that consumers love. Several regions offer distinct vanilla beans that can set your product apart:
- Madagascar: Known for its creamy, sweet, and mellow flavor, Madagascar vanilla is favored by chefs and bakers.
- Mexico: The birthplace of vanilla, Mexico offers beans with a bold, spicy, woody aroma for those seeking robust flavor.
- Tahitian (French Polynesia): Prized for floral, fruity notes, Tahitian vanilla adds sophistication to any recipe.
Select the region based on your desired flavor profile. Partnering with reliable, ethical sources ensures consistency and quality in your supply chain. Investing in top-quality vanilla beans helps craft a standout product and build a reputation for authenticity and flavor excellence.

Crafting a Business Plan and Navigating Registration
A detailed business plan is your roadmap to vanilla extract success. It outlines your vision, goals, market strategies, and financial projections to guide your decisions. Once your plan is ready, tackle registration and licensing with these steps:
Choose a Business Structure: Decide between a sole proprietorship, partnership, LLC, or corporation, considering tax and liability implications.
Register Your Business Name: Ensure your name is unique, register it with your state, and secure a domain for your online presence.
Obtain an EIN: Apply for an Employer Identification Number from the IRS for tax purposes and to open a business bank account.
State and Local Licenses: Research and obtain necessary business licenses based on your location.
Food Production Permits: Acquire permits from the health department to ensure your facilities meet safety standards.
Trademark Registration: Protect your brand and product names by registering trademarks.
By following these steps, you’ll establish a solid legal foundation, allowing you to focus on crafting and selling quality vanilla extract.

Vanilla Extract Production Process
Bean Selection & Preparation: Select high-quality vanilla beans, split lengthwise to expose seeds for maximum flavor.
Extraction Process: Combine beans with high-proof alcohol in a stainless steel extractor, maintaining temperature and ratio for optimal extraction. Regularly sample to monitor flavor.
Aging: Age the mixture for several weeks in a temperature-controlled, dark environment. Conduct periodic quality checks.
Filtration: Filter the aged mixture to remove impurities, ensuring a clear extract.
Quality Testing: Perform sensory evaluations and lab tests for flavor, alcohol content, and purity to ensure consistency.
Bottling & Packaging: Bottle the extract in sterilized, airtight containers. Choose packaging that reflects your brand and preserves the product.
Final Inspection: Conduct a final quality check on bottled products to ensure they meet all standards, fostering trust and satisfaction.

Exploring Diverse Distribution Channels
To maximize the reach of your vanilla extract, explore diverse distribution channels. Each offers unique benefits and can expand your customer base.
E-commerce Platforms: Utilize online sales through Amazon, Etsy, and your website to reach a global audience. Optimize listings with engaging photos, compelling descriptions, and positive reviews.
Local Retail Partnerships: Collaborate with local grocery, gourmet, and health food stores to boost visibility and strengthen community ties. Offer in-store tastings to convert potential buyers into loyal customers.
Collaborations with Food Manufacturers: Partner with manufacturers to incorporate your vanilla extract into their products, providing a steady bulk sales channel and enhancing their offerings.
Subscription Boxes: Work with subscription box services focused on gourmet or artisanal products to reach new audiences and create recurring revenue streams.
Diversifying distribution channels expands your reach and builds a resilient business model.
